Description

Please join us for a very special Lunch and Learn on Wednesday, April 23, 12:30 PM for a Yom Hashoah – Holocaust Memorial Day Commemoration: Hearing “The Last Ones” Speak

With Special Guests,

Dr. Miriam Klein Kassenoff will tell of her family’s escape from Nazi Occupied Europe.

Leslie Benitah Gelrubin, journalist and producer, will present clips from her documentary, The Last Ones

Both will be in conversation with Stephanie Rosen, founder of 3G Miami.
